On February 13, the Swiss population was able to vote on a citizens' initiative concerning tobacco advertising. Adopted with nearly 57% of the vote, this popular initiative will not be translated into law until next year, but in this country which remains "homeland of tobacco multinationals", the associations will ensure that the provisions of their text do not go up in smoke.

And as much to say that the result is received differently according to the protagonists. " We are extremely happy. The people have nevertheless understood that health is more important than economic interests« , said Stephanie de Borba, of The League Against Cancer.
For his part, a spokesperson for Philip Morris International told AFP: Individual freedom is on a slippery slope“. Finally, some elected officials denounce the hygienist and well-meaning tendency of society. " Today we talk about cigarettes, (tomorrow) it will be alcohol, meat » says Philip Bauer, member of the Council of States and deputy of the Liberal-Radical party, who also criticizes a « dictatorship of political correctness"
